Andhra Bank invites online job applications for the appointment to the post of Probationary Officers (PO) in Special Drive to clear backlog of OBC vacancies. Those applicants who have taken CWE of PO/MT conducted by IBPS can apply for Andhra Bank PO recruitment 2012 on the basis of CWE PO results 2011 issued by IBPS.

Andhra Bank PO Recruitment 2012 Details:
There are total 89 vacancies for Probationary Officers under JMGS – I scale out of which 1 vacancy for OC and 1 vacancy for VI in Andhra Bank.
Probation Period:
Selected candidates have to serve the probation period of 2 years.
Indemnity Bond: selected candidates as Probationary Officers in Andhra Bank will be required to execute a Service Bond for a minimum period of 5 years or to pay the Bank sum of Rs. 75000.
Andhra Bank PO Recruitment 2012 Eligibility Criteria:
Name of the Post – Scale – Age Limit
Probationary Officers – JMGS – 1- 21 years to 30 years
Educational Qualification:
Candidates should have a degree of graduation with minimum 60% marks or equivalent CGPA from any university recognized by UGC.
IBPS Score:
TWS: 141 and above in CWE for IBPS PO/MT 2011
Computer knowledge is essential for the applicants.

Selection Procedure:
Selection of a candidate will be made on the basis of performance in CWE conducted by IBPS and group discussion/interview held by the Bank. Candidates have to secure minimum 14 marks from total 35 marks to qualify the personal interview.
